SA1 36324 has a population of 451 — above average. 1.6% of people in SA1 36324 are aged 65 or over, among the lowest in the country (below both the Victoria average of 16.8% and the national 17.2%). The most common age structure is Young adults (25–44) at 49%, ahead of Children (0–14) (25%). The median age in SA1 36324 is 30 yrs, among the lowest in the country (below both the Victoria average of 38 yrs and the national 38 yrs).

59.9% of residents in SA1 36324 were born overseas — among the highest in the country (above both the Victoria average of 30.0% and the national 27.7%). The most common country of birth is Australia at 31%, ahead of India (18%).

57.4% of residents in SA1 36324 use a language other than English at home — among the highest in the country (above both the Victoria average of 27.6% and the national 22.3%). 6.9% of people in SA1 36324 speak English not well or not at all, well above average (above both the Victoria average of 4.4% and the national 3.4%). The most common language used at home is English only at 34%, ahead of Mandarin (15%).

31.3% of people in SA1 36324 report no religion — below average (below both the Victoria average of 39.3% and the national 38.9%). The most common religious affiliation is No religion at 31%, ahead of Christianity (27%).

48.4% of adults in SA1 36324 hold a bachelor degree or higher — well above average (above both the Victoria average of 29.2% and the national 26.3%). 78.2% of people in SA1 36324 finished Year 12, well above average (above both the Victoria average of 61.8% and the national 58.8%). The most common highest year of school is Year 12 at 78%, ahead of Year 10 (5%).

Households in SA1 36324 earn a median $2,485 a week — well above average (above both the Victoria average of $1,759 and the national $1,746). 46.0% of households in SA1 36324 bring in $3,000 or more a week, well above average (above both the Victoria average of 22.7% and the national 22.6%). The most common household income distribution is $1,500–$2,999 at 38%, ahead of $4,000 or more (24%). Families in SA1 36324 earn a median $2,650 a week, well above average (above both the Victoria average of $2,136 and the national $2,120).

11.3% of residents in SA1 36324 live with a long-term health condition — among the lowest in the country (below both the Victoria average of 27.4% and the national 27.7%). 4.9% of people in SA1 36324 report a mental health condition, well below average (below both the Victoria average of 8.8% and the national 8.8%). The most common long-term health conditions reported is Mental health at 5%, ahead of Asthma (4%). 2.9% of residents in SA1 36324 need help with daily activities, well below average (below both the Victoria average of 5.9% and the national 5.8%).

9.7% of people in SA1 36324 volunteer — well below average (below both the Victoria average of 13.3% and the national 14.1%). 0.0% of people in SA1 36324 have served in the Defence Force, among the lowest in the country (below both the Victoria average of 2.0% and the national 2.8%). 4.7% of people in SA1 36324 provide unpaid care to others, among the lowest in the country (below both the Victoria average of 12.9% and the national 11.9%).

Households in SA1 36324 average 3.3 people — well above average. In SA1 36324, 10.5% of households are people living alone, well below average (below both the Victoria average of 25.9% and the national 25.6%). The most common family composition is Couples with children at 73%, ahead of Couples without children (16%). One-parent families make up 8.4% of families in SA1 36324, well below average (below both the Victoria average of 13.3% and the national 14.1%).

The median weekly rent in SA1 36324 is $450 — above average (above both the Victoria average of $370 and the national $375). 100.0% of dwellings in SA1 36324 are separate houses, among the highest in the country (above both the Victoria average of 73.4% and the national 72.3%). The most common how homes are owned or rented is Owned with a mortgage at 44%, ahead of Rented (41%). 10.5% of homes in SA1 36324 are owned outright, among the lowest in the country (below both the Victoria average of 32.2% and the national 31.0%).

0.0% of households in SA1 36324 have no car — among the lowest in the country (below both the Victoria average of 7.6% and the national 7.4%). 36.2% of workers in SA1 36324 work from home, well above average (above both the Victoria average of 25.7% and the national 21.0%). The most common how people get to work is Car (driver) at 38%, ahead of Worked at home (36%). 3.3% of workers in SA1 36324 get to work by public transport, above average (above both the Victoria average of 2.9% and the national 3.1%).

80.5% of people in SA1 36324 changed address in the past five years — among the highest in the country (above both the Victoria average of 40.0% and the national 40.7%). 28.1% of SA1 36324's residents arrived from overseas within the past five years, well above average (above both the Victoria average of 15.6% and the national 14.5%).

Unemployment in SA1 36324 stands at 10.4% — well above average (above both the Victoria average of 5.0% and the national 5.1%). 67.6% of workers in SA1 36324 are employed full-time, well above average (above both the Victoria average of 59.2% and the national 58.9%). The most common industries people work in is Professional & technical at 17%, ahead of Finance & insurance (10%). Labour-force participation in SA1 36324 is 70.7%, well above average (above both the Victoria average of 62.4% and the national 61.1%).
